Mass vs. Weight

Questions Are some objects harder to get to start moving than others? Are some objects harder to slow down than others? WHY???

Mass vs. Weight Mass Weight The amount of matter an object is made up of Measure of an object’s resistance to motion (inertia) Measured using a balance Weight The pull of gravity on an object Is a force  units = Newtons Measured using a scale

Mass vs. Weight As gravitational fields change… Does an object’s mass change? Does an object’s weight change? As gravitational force increases, an object’s… Weight ______ Mass ______

Calculating Weight Equation W = mg W = weight m = mass g = constant Earth constant -

Calculating Weight - 10 N/kg Equation W = m x g W = weight m = mass g = constant Earth constant - 0.01 N/g - 10 N/kg Moon constant -

Calculating Weight - 10 N/kg Equation W = m x k W = weight m = mass k = constant Earth constant - 0.01 N/g - 10 N/kg Moon constant - 0.0017 N/g - 1.7 N/kg
